### Step 6 — Deploy bulk-edit patch (AdminGrid)

Reviewer: confirm the bulk-edit endpoint for the Pellwick admin table is behind the feature flag, then sign the release bundle before pushing to staging. Batch size capped at 500 rows. Rollback script included in the bundle. Sign with the current deploy key, shown below.

rollout seal: bky9_PeXH1fTLY

Test plan — Wagefort export format change

The Wagefort payroll export moves from fixed-width records to delimited files in the next release. Verify: header row present, decimal amounts use two places, and employee rows sort by department code. Run both old and new formats through the reconciliation script and diff totals. New team members should use the staging export endpoint only, authenticating with the token below.

portal login ticket: eyJhbGciOiJIUzI1NiIsInR5cCI6IkpXVCJ9.eyJzdWIiOiIwEOsktwVNwIn0.-UJU3fdyyCgG

Vellum Gate supports hot-reloading of its runtime config. On SIGHUP, the daemon re-reads the active config map, validates it, and swaps atomically. Invalid configs are rejected; the old values stay live. No pod restart required for rate limits, log levels, or upstream timeouts. TLS and listener ports still require a full restart.

Release managers: trigger the reload from the Quarrystone console after each promotion, then verify the audit line in the gateway log. The values below are what production should reflect after reload.

deployment values, yahag-tawef:
ZORWYN_HOST=zorwyn.tolvaqlabs.internal
ZORWYN_PORT=9300